About Brenda J. Tripathi

Brenda J. Tripathi is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Immunology and Allergy and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, having authored 103 papers that have together received 4.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Glaucoma and retinal disorders (42 papers), Retinal Diseases and Treatments (20 papers), Connexins and lens biology (18 papers), Corneal Surgery and Treatments (15 papers), Corneal surgery and disorders (13 papers), Protease and Inhibitor Mechanisms (12 papers), Retinal Development and Disorders (12 papers) and Ocular Surface and Contact Lens (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ophthalmology (2.6k cit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(1.6k citations) and Immunology and Allergy (204 citations). Brenda J. Tripathi has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Mexico and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Ramesh C. Tripathi, Ramesh C. Tripathi, Junping Li, Navaneet S.C. Borisuth, Anthony P. Adamis, Charles B. Millard, Eugene Wolff, Anthony J. Bron, R C Tripathi and Junping Li. Their work appears in journals such as Gastroenterology, The Journal of Physiology and Ophthalmology.
